[Free radicals and aging].

A Crastes de Paulet1

  • 1Laboratoire de Biochimie A, Institut de Biologie, Montpellier.

Annales De Biologie Clinique
|January 1, 1990
PubMed
Summary
This summary is machine-generated.

The free radical theory suggests aging results from an imbalance between damaging free radicals and the body's antioxidant defenses. This imbalance causes cellular damage, leading to functional decline and aging.
